Freigeben über


API-Referenzen

Wie in der Registrierungsverwaltung erläutert, können Anwendungen, die Benachrichtigungshubs verwenden, auswählen, um sowohl von ihren mobilen Anwendungen als auch von ihren App-Back-Ends auf Hubs zuzugreifen.

Benachrichtigungshubs stellen zwei API-Sammlungen zur Verfügung, um diese beiden Zugriffsmuster besser zu unterstützen: eine Sammlung, die von mobilen Apps zum Registrieren für Benachrichtigungen verwendet wird, und eine Sammlung, die im Anwendungs-Back-End zum Ausführen der Registrierungsverwaltung sowie zum Senden von Benachrichtigungen verwendet wird. Außerdem stellen Benachrichtigungshubs eine REST-API-Schicht bereit, die alle Funktionen umfasst, die durch die Back-End-API bereitgestellt werden.

Geräte-APIs

Geräte-APIs werden nur zum Registrieren von Geräten von mobilen Apps verwendet (aus Sicherheitsgründen stellen sie keine Send-Methoden zur Verfügung). Sie automatisieren die Verwaltung von Informationen, die sich auf Benachrichtigungshubs beziehen, im lokalen Speicher des Geräts, und sie unterstützen die Registrierung für ein einzelnes PNS (die Geräte-APIs von Windows Store registrieren beispielsweise nur Windows-Geräte).

Benachrichtigungshubs stellen zurzeit die folgenden Geräte-API-Sammlungen zu Verfügung:

Back-End-APIs

Back-End-APIs werden zum Senden von Benachrichtigungen sowie für die Registrierungsverwaltung aus dem Back-End für alle Plattformen verwendet.

Benachrichtigungshubs stellen zurzeit die folgenden Back-End-API-Sammlungen zu Verfügung:

REST-APIs

Sämtliche Funktionen von Benachtichtigungshubs sind mithilfe der REST-APIs verfügbar. Weitere Informationen finden Sie unter Benachrichtigungshubs-REST-APIs.